Output 3840ae8f7907154487279e17bd75a590d5118c31b8c884ffacaaaaf016006391:0

value
1333618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beb86e55f952f279789e12cc0e48a78b13e5128b OP_EQUAL
address
3K5TFUumwZx2bSKYPQTjMCfCiBYkVDQpfq
transaction
3840ae8f7907154487279e17bd75a590d5118c31b8c884ffacaaaaf016006391
spent
true